A 20-foot recreation of the Donkey Kong arcade cabinet is coming to New York, and it will be fully playable.

A playable 20-foot Donkey Kong arcade machine is coming to the Museum of Play in New York

The game’s cabinet will be 370% bigger than the original 1981 Donkey Kong machine, and is constructed from an aluminium frame with MDF fiberboard.This will be achieved with a second, normal-sized joystick and fire button on a pedestal that will stand in front of the machine.of America, will run an original 1981 Donkey Kong motherboard, to ensure it plays authentically.

The Strong’s vice president for exhibits, Jon-Paul Dyson, said in a statement: “Donkey Kong is a true titan in the video game world – both in terms of character size and the iconic status of the game – so it lends itself perfectly to this playful, whimsical installation.
